From d1f2d96ec3d83967a3edad1868f86a572bd1ebf1 Mon Sep 17 00:00:00 2001 From: Nawawi Jamili Date: Sat, 7 Dec 2013 03:55:32 +0800 Subject: [PATCH] ui-lib conversion -> krb5/index.cgi --- krb5/index.cgi | 69 +++++++++++++++++++------------------------------- 1 file changed, 26 insertions(+), 43 deletions(-) diff --git a/krb5/index.cgi b/krb5/index.cgi index 4a3abca0f..e5b67ad2f 100755 --- a/krb5/index.cgi +++ b/krb5/index.cgi @@ -14,49 +14,32 @@ if (!-r $config{'krb5_conf'}) { %conf = &get_config(); -print "
\n"; -print "\n"; -print "
\n"; -print "\n"; +print &ui_form_start("save.cgi", "post"); +print &ui_table_start($text{'logging'}, undef, 2); +print &ui_table_row(&hlink("$text{'default_log'}","default_log"), + &ui_filebox("default_log", $conf{'default_log'}, 40)); +print &ui_table_row(&hlink("$text{'kdc_log'}","kdc_log"), + &ui_filebox("kdc_log", $conf{'kdc_log'}, 40)); +print &ui_table_row(&hlink("$text{'admin_log'}","admin_log"), + &ui_filebox("admin_log", $conf{'admin_server_log'}, 40)); +print &ui_columns_header([$text{'libdefaults'},""]); -print "\n"; -print "\n"; - -print "\n"; -print "\n"; - -print "\n"; -print "\n"; - -print "\n"; - -print "\n"; -print "\n"; - -print "\n"; -print "\n"; - -print "\n"; -print "\n"; - -print "\n"; -printf "\n", - ($conf{'dns_lookup_kdc'} eq "false") ? "checked" : ""; - -print "\n"; -print "\n"; - -print "\n"; -print "\n"; - -print "
$text{'logging'}
",&hlink("$text{'default_log'}","default_log"),"", - &file_chooser_button("default_log", 1), "
",&hlink("$text{'kdc_log'}","kdc_log"),"", - &file_chooser_button("kdc_log", 1), "
",&hlink("$text{'admin_log'}","admin_log"),"", - &file_chooser_button("admin_log", 1), "
$text{'libdefaults'}
",&hlink("$text{'default_realm'}","default_realm"),"
",&hlink("$text{'domain'}","domain"),"
",&hlink("$text{'default_domain'}","default_domain"),"
",&hlink("$text{'dns_kdc'}","dns_kdc")," $text{'yes'}\n", - ($conf{'dns_lookup_kdc'} eq "false") ? "" : "checked"; -printf " $text{'no'}
",&hlink("$text{'default_kdc'}","default_kdc")," : "; -print "
",&hlink("$text{'default_admin'}","default_admin")," : "; -print "
\n"; -print "
\n"; +print &ui_table_row(&hlink("$text{'default_realm'}","default_realm"), + &ui_textbox("default_realm", $conf{'realm'}, 40)); +print &ui_table_row(&hlink("$text{'domain'}","domain"), + &ui_textbox("domain", $conf{'domain'}, 40)); +print &ui_table_row(&hlink("$text{'default_domain'}","default_domain"), + &ui_textbox("default_domain", $conf{'default_domain'}, 40)); +print &ui_table_row(&hlink("$text{'dns_kdc'}","dns_kdc"), + &ui_oneradio("dns_kdc","1", $text{'yes'}, ( $conf{'dns_lookup_kdc'} eq "false" ? 0 : 1) )." ". + &ui_oneradio("dns_kdc","0", $text{'no'}, ( $conf{'dns_lookup_kdc'} eq "false" ? 1 : 0) ) ); +print &ui_table_row(&hlink("$text{'default_kdc'}","default_kdc"), + &ui_textbox("default_kdc", $conf{'kdc'}, 40).":".&ui_textbox("kdc", $conf{'kdc_port'}, 5)); +print &ui_table_row(&hlink("$text{'default_admin'}","default_admin"), + &ui_textbox("default_admin", $conf{'admin_server'}, 40).":".&ui_textbox("default_admin_port", $conf{'admin_port'}, 5)); +print ui_table_end(); +print "
"; +print &ui_submit($text{'save'}); +print &ui_form_end(); &ui_print_footer("/", $text{'index'});